JUSTICE CHAKRADHARI SHARAN SINGH) DATE: 29-09-2015 We have, in a separate judgment, delivered today, upheld the constitutional validity of "Article 3.3.3 of the Statues for appointment of teachers (Assistant Professor Grade) for the Universities of Bihar, 2014"

and the marking scheme contemplated in Schedule-V of the said Statutes, in a batch of

Patna High Court CWJC No.14780 of 2015 dt.29-09-2015 3/3 writ applications, the leading case being C.W.J.C. Nos.18016 of 2012 (Dr. Rakesh Kumar Singh & Ors. vs. The Union of India & Ors.). Similar issues have been raised in these two writ applications, filed under Article 226 of the Constitution of India, which are dismissed in terms of our decision aforesaid.
